The Book of Secret Knowledge is a large collection of cheatsheets, manuals, one-liners, security/devops resources, and practical engineering links.
The Art of Command Line is a one-page guide to Bash, Unix commands, one-liners, debugging, and productive terminal work.
Clash Verge Rev is a Tauri-based graphical client for Clash Meta/mihomo on Windows, macOS, and Linux.
RustDesk is an open source remote desktop application with optional self-run relay/rendezvous servers and clients for many systems.
DevOps Exercises is a large collection of questions and exercises covering Linux, networking, Kubernetes, Terraform, CI/CD, clouds, databases, and SRE.
Netdata is an observability and monitoring system for near real-time metrics from servers, services, and applications.
HackingTool is an educational collection of information security tools for labs, CTFs, and authorized testing.
Ventoy is a multiboot USB utility: install it once, then copy ISO images onto the drive.
Pi-hole is a DNS filter for blocking ads and unwanted domains across a whole network.
Termux App is an Android application that provides a terminal environment with Linux packages on a phone or tablet.
Homebrew is a package manager for macOS and Linux that installs CLI tools, apps, and libraries through formulae and casks.
